Immediately after the holiday ended,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d., a leading vaccine company worth over 100 billion yuan, announced a significant deal valued at more than 20 billion yuan.

On October 9,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. announced that it had signed an agreement with GSK, becoming the importer and distributor of GSK's recombinant shingles vaccine within the cooperation region in China*. The term of this collaboration extends from October 8, 2023, to December 31, 2026, with a total procurement amount of 20.6 billion yuan.

Upon the release of the news, the A-share market surged. The stock price of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. jumped on the spot, directly rising from the closing price of 48.67 yuan per share on September 28 to 58.40 yuan per share, with an increase of 19.99%.The total market value soared to more than 140 billion yuan, with a substantial increase of 23.355 billion yuan in just one day!This trend continued further, with the company's share price reaching as high as 60.45 yuan per share on October 11.

Subsequently, multiple securities companies made predictions, believing that with the boost of GSK's shingles vaccine (trade name: Shingrix), the performance of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. will continue to grow, and they have maintained a "buy" investment rating.

The investors' frenzy is historically justified. With the assistance of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d., Merck's HPV vaccines (human papillomavirus vaccines, including quadrivalent and nonavalent) have sold like hotcakes in China over the past few years, generating a total revenue of approximately 35 billion yuan, accounting for more than half of China’s entire HPV vaccine market. In the first half of 2023, the global sales of Merck’s two HPV vaccines surged by 47%, with China being a major driving force.

Despite criticism due to its revenue mainly coming from代理 products, the sales capability of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. is impressive; the significant rise in stock price itself is also a recognition of its sales ability. Similar to the HPV vaccine, the shingles vaccine also follows the "internet celebrity" route, primarily marketing on the "filial piety" appeal.Will this product repeat the sales myth of the HPV vaccine after more and more people learn about shingles and the shingles vaccine?

"Internet Celebrity Vaccine" Stumbles in China

Although many people are unfamiliar with shingles and the shingles vaccine, such products have long become a "red ocean" in the R&D field.Behind the optimistic sentiment in the investment market lies a harsh reality: the global performance growth of GSK's popular vaccine has slowed, facing strong competition from domestically produced vaccines in China.

From the market performance, the shingles vaccine does have the potential to become a "big hit."

The shingles vaccine has long been a coveted product in China's industry. According to incomplete statistics from public data, at least 21 local companies have already positioned themselves in this product. Among them are not only Baike Biotechnology, but also strong players such as Shanghai Institute of Biological Products, Wantai BioPharm, Walvax Biotechnology, and CanSino Biologics. Even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. has preclinical projects under research.

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. is now representing GSK's product "Shingrix," which has seen a rapid surge in sales since its approval in the U.S. in 2017. Not only did it achieve impressive sales of £7.84 billion (equivalent to $9.65 billion, or 7.05 billion RMB) in its first full year on the market, but it also maintained steady growth despite the impact of the pandemic. By 2022, annual sales of the product had reached £2.958 billion (equivalent to $3.643 billion, or 26.6 billion RMB), marking a year-on-year increase of 72%.

The company plans that by 2026, the sales of this vaccine will reach 4 billion pounds.

For Shingrix, the European and American markets are currently the mainstay. However, data shows that growth has shown signs of fatigue, especially in the U.S. market, where the growth rate in the first half of 2023 was only 10%, pulling the overall growth down to a low of 20%. In contrast, emerging markets such as China are very important drivers, with annual performance growth exceeding 100%.

However, the rapid growth momentum in China today has also been challenged.Although the sales growth rate of Shingrix in markets outside Europe and America remained above 100% in the first half of the year, it faces challenges in the potential market of China— in the first half of this year, "Ganwei," a shingles vaccine produced by Baike Biotechnology, obtained the approval document from the National Medical Products Administration.

The domestically produced shingles vaccine adopts the previous generation's live attenuated virus vaccine technology route. According to Baik Biology's response to investor inquiries, the effectiveness of this vaccine is "comparable to products using the same technical route," and in terms of safety, it has "fewer side effects compared to the recombinant technology route."

The company referred to a product of the same technical route, Merck's Zostavax, which was launched in 2006 and has now been withdrawn from the market. The data published in those years showed that the highest protection rate of this product was 69.8%. Before the approval of Shingrix, it was a product with annual sales of 600-700 million US dollars. According to the instruction of the herpes zoster vaccine of Baike Biotechnology, its protective power for people over 40 years old is 57.63%.

More importantly, the price of domestically produced vaccines is more affordable — the single-dose price of Shingrix is 1,598 yuan, with a total of two doses required for full immunization, amounting to around 3,200 yuan; whereas Ganwe only costs 1,369 yuan per dose and requires just one shot. Additionally, in terms of application scope, Shingrix is suitable for people aged 50 and above, while Ganwe also covers the age group between 40 and 50.

Although the data alone suggests that Shingrix has better protective efficacy, in practice, Recombinant Zoster Vaccine has already demonstrated significant market competitiveness.

According to research data from Zhongtai Securities, the batch release volume of domestic herpes zoster vaccines in just the first half of the year reached 1.22 million doses, with Ganwei accounting for 40%. Data from the Institute for Food and Drug Control shows that as of September, China has approved 26 batches of herpes zoster vaccines this year. Although this represents an increase compared to last year, the proportion has declined. The number of batch releases by Baike Biotech already accounts for 69%.

The entry of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. not only broke the *advantage of Shingrix in China, but also rapidly eroded the market that might have belonged to Shingrix. LZ901 (the core product of Green Bamboo Biotech), also a recombinant protein vaccine, is simultaneously preparing for a "head-to-head" study with Shingrix and planning to set its price at a new low of 500 to 800 yuan.

It can be said that the Chinese shingles vaccine market will soon enter a phase of intense competition. Before the first-mover advantage completely fades, it has become imperative for GSK to quickly bring in a strong sales partner.

Huddle for warmth

In fact, Shingrix is widely recognized as an excellent product — earlier published data showed that the protection rate of Shingrix can reach up to 97.2%. Moreover, due to the inherent characteristics of its technical approach, as a recombinant protein vaccine, Shingrix can also be used for patients with immunodeficiency or immunosuppressive conditions who cannot receive live attenuated vaccines.

Six years ago, this product directly pushed Zostavax, which had been on the market for more than 10 years, out of the U.S. market due to its overwhelming superiority in the protective efficacy of live attenuated vaccines. It quickly became a blockbuster product with annual sales exceeding $1 billion.

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. has a successful track record of "managing" the HPV vaccine market, which has led to seven consecutive years of profitable performance.

However, the cooperation between the two is more about seeking mutual support in adversity than a powerful alliance.

After 2015, under the reform of China's new drug research and development evaluation and approval system, the speed of new drug development in China has far exceeded the past. This has also shortened the window period for new products from multinational pharmaceutical companies. GSK's wrong choice of partner also led to Shingrix failing to fully capitalize on its first-mover advantage.

Data shows that Shingrix was launched in China in 2019. Besides its own vaccine team, they initially chose Shanghai Pharmaceuticals as the agent.

According to the 2020 annual report of Shanghai Pharmaceuticals, Xin An Li Shi started its vaccination in early July that year. The total sales for the year reached 487 million yuan, accounting for 9.3% of the company's vaccine business revenue that year, showing relatively outstanding performance.

Thereafter, Shanghai Pharmaceuticals’ financial reports did not disclose further details about the sales of Shingrix. Judging from the overall decline in its import agency vaccine revenue, the sales outlook is not optimistic — this segment of Shanghai Pharma's income stabilized at around 4.4 billion yuan in both 2021 and 2022, a significant drop compared to 5.2 billion yuan in 2020.

In particular, Shingrix belongs to Category II vaccines (vaccines that require out-of-pocket payment), and the announcement by Shanghai Pharmaceuticals also explicitly stated that the sales of such products have been affected by epidemic control measures.

Obviously, the already extremely short "window period" for Shingrix has been wasted like this.

GSK’s senior management set a target as early as 2021 for Shingrix to achieve annual sales of £4 billion by 2026. One of the key markets driving this goal is China, where the market has just been warmed up to promote public awareness of the shingles vaccine. However, with competitors already stepping in and more new rivals on the horizon, GSK has been forced to reconsider its strategy.

In the face of upcoming fierce competition,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. is an excellent choice.

Judging from the sales outlets alone, Shingrix has tremendous appeal. According to reports by the Beijing Business Today and other media, as of 2022, Shingrix had reached over 6,500 marketing points, covering 306 cities across China.

According to the 2022 annual report of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d., the company collaborates with over 30,000 grassroots health service points across China and has more than 3,000 sales personnel. Even during the pandemic control period, the batch release volume of Zhifei Biological’s distributed products (mainly HPV vaccines, pentavalent rotavirus vaccines, etc.) continued to grow. In 2022, the batch release volume of the two HPV vaccines maintained growth of over 50%.

One more critical point is that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. will place significant emphasis on the market promotion of Shingrix, as they are currently at a bottleneck stage.

In terms of sales strength, Shanghai Pharmaceutical is not weak. As the second-largest giant in China's pharmaceutical industry, the company ranks among the top 50 in the global pharmaceutical sector.

For this large company with revenue exceeding 200 billion yuan, the importance of acting as an agent for imported vaccines is not that significant. Moreover, a subtle shift in focus of its vaccine business can be observed in the company's financial reports in recent years — the company’s layout of the vaccine industry chain has expanded from import distribution to production and research and development. Its subsidiary, CanSino, and its COVID-19 vaccine under research have become key areas of focus.

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. has long relied on imported agency products, mainly HPV vaccines, for its performance growth. From the perspective of market competition, domestically produced nine-valent HPV vaccines are also accelerating their market entry, which will add pressure to the performance growth of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d.

In terms of data, although the company's revenue was still growing positively in 2022, its net profit had already shown negative growth. Although both revenue and net profit resumed positive growth in the first half of 2023, the magnitude was much lower than before.

For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. at present, Shingrix also represents an opportunity to seek a second growth curve.

What are the other challenges?

Objectively speaking, there is a demand among the Chinese public for the shingles vaccine.

Herpes Zoster: An infectious skin disease caused by the reactivation of the varicella-zoster virus, which remains latent in the human body for a long time. The virus lies dormant in the dorsal root ganglia of the spinal cord or the cranial nerve ganglia and mainly spreads along peripheral nerves during outbreaks. It is colloquially referred to as "waist-wrapping dragon" in folk terms.

"It feels like using a needle to pierce from underneath the skin to the surface." Zeng Rongshan, a virology expert who once suffered from shingles, told Huxiu that the treatment of the disease usually takes at least one month, during which patients often struggle to sleep due to pain. Some patients have even expressed that the pain made them contemplate suicide.

A considerable proportion of patients will also have sequelae and complications such as neuralgia, which severely affects the quality of life. If herpes zoster occurs in areas like the eyes or ears, it results in ophthalmic herpes zoster or otic herpes zoster, which can seriously lead to facial paralysis, encephalitis, epilepsy, and even death – although the mortality rate is very low, with no more than 5 cases per million people annually.

Like most viral diseases, there is no "*cure" for this disease. Clinically, antiviral treatments mainly involve the use of drugs such as Acyclovir, Famciclovir, and Valacyclovir. Vaccines are considered to be the *effective means of prevention and control.

Research data shows that there are approximately 2.77 million new cases of herpes zoster in China each year.

Moreover, herpes zoster does not confer lifelong immunity after a single episode; 1% to 10% of patients may experience a recurrence. This also implies that individuals who have had herpes zoster still have a need for vaccination as a preventive measure.

According to Frost & Sullivan, by 2030, the market size of herpes zoster vaccines in China is expected to reach 28.1 billion yuan, increasing nearly 4600% compared to 2021, far exceeding the global market's growth of approximately 400% during the same period.

In the future, as aging deepens — by 2035, the number of people over 60 will exceed 400 million — and the trend of younger patients expands, the demand for herpes zoster vaccines in China is expected to continue growing. It can be said that the Chinese market is becoming increasingly important for global herpes zoster vaccine suppliers.

However, as more and more domestically produced products enter the market, how much each company can earn will depend on their own abilities.

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. Takes on the "Military Order" of Shingrix, the Challenge is Also Very Severe.

Based on the contract,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d.'s committed procurement amount for the first year reached 3.44 billion yuan. Calculating with approximately 1,600 yuan per dose, at least 2.15 million doses need to be sold, involving millions of people.

In the absence of competition, Shanghai Pharmaceuticals' performance was sales of 4.87 billion yuan in half a year, equivalent to approximately 300,000 doses, covering 150,000 people. According to a research report by Zhongtai Securities, the batch release volume of Shingrix in the first half of this year was only 720,000 doses. Industry insiders believe that Shingrix's sales in the three years since its launch may not even reach 2 billion yuan.

Behind it, being expensive is almost an original sin.

In recent years, public awareness of shingles has been increasing, and willingness to get vaccinated has also improved. However, among the various factors affecting the actualization of vaccination willingness, price remains the primary one.

This disease tends to occur when the human immune system is weak, and it is more common in middle-aged and elderly groups, cancer patients, and those receiving hormone treatments. In China, the incidence of this disease has been increasing year by year, with a trend toward affecting younger people. Young individuals who frequently stay up late, experience high life pressure, and have fast-paced jobs—especially business professionals—are also highly susceptible. However, the elderly remain the primary affected group.

A Review of the Clinical and Epidemiological Characteristics of Herpes Zoster by Liu Na et al. from the Chinese Center for Disease Control and Prevention shows that: In the population aged 50 and above, 14 out of every 1,000 people are affected, while in those aged 49 and below, only 4 are affected. Moreover, the population aged 50 and above is the most price-sensitive.

In a survey conducted in Chongming District, a relatively economically developed area in Shanghai, 475 out of 845 respondents (approximately 52.21% of the total) were unwilling to receive the shingles vaccine. Of these more than 400 individuals, nearly half (about 44.42%, or 211 people) were unwilling to get vaccinated due to the high cost of the vaccine.Researchers also pointed out that the vaccination cost of 3,200 yuan imposes a heavy economic burden on middle-aged and elderly people.

This actually provides room for domestically produced vaccines, which are less efficacious but much cheaper. Chang Rongshan believes that if similar domestic products enter the market, their price could be only 30% of Shingrix, and even so, manufacturers could still enjoy a gross profit margin of over 95%. This is also where the opportunity lies for more latecomers.

As for Shingrix's主打 "family ties" and "filial piety," these marketing strategies also face challenges amid the broader trend of consumer downgrade. Especially after the launch of a domestically produced vaccine in China, which follows the same recombinant protein technology route, demonstrates non-inferiority in “head-to-head” trials, and is priced significantly lower than Shingrix.

In this case, it is worth noting whether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. can achieve a doubling of its performance within * years amidst competition from domestically produced alternatives. The procurement amount commitments of 6.88 billion yuan for the second year and 10.32 billion yuan for the third year will not only positively impact the company's operating revenue and profits but also bring significant pressure.

From this perspective, the frenzy in the secondary market regarding the recent collaboration between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. and GSK may have come too early.

On the other hand, Chongqing Zhifei Biological Products Co., Ltd. entering the market through agency has also put pressure on local vaccine enterprises.In addition to price advantages, domestically produced products must also demonstrate higher quality.
